Meeting notes — Records team, 14 March

Agreed: master copies of the Arden Hollow brochure go to Pellworth Print Co. by courier, not post. Originals stay in the fire cabinet; only the stamped duplicates travel, logged out by two signatories. Return expected within five days. The courier hand-over follows the instruction below.

courier memo of yawep-yafog: the pramir ulaix courier leaves the ulavan aldix frair zorok oliiel joreth rusdor fenvan ledger at gate 1305 under passcode 514738

# Env file — Cartwheel dispatch, driver-assignment heuristic
# Scope: staging only. Do not promote to prod.
# The heuristic weights (proximity, shift balance, refusal rate) are tuned
# for the Velmont pilot region and will misbehave elsewhere.
# Review notes: heuristic service runs unprivileged; it reads weights
# read-only from the tuning store and writes nothing back.
# Only one sensitive value exists in this file: the tuning-store access
# credential, consumed at boot and never logged.
# That credential is set on the following line.

secret setting of faduf-bahop: LEDGER_TOKEN8=c3b363be

Agreed to keep rule severity at warning level for two sprints before enforcing blocking checks in CI. The terminology dictionary will live alongside the style guide so maintainers can propose additions via standard review. Open question on handling generated API docs was deferred; a spike is planned for next sprint. Rule exceptions must be annotated inline with a justification comment. Ownership of the linter configuration and exception approvals was confirmed in the meeting.

account owner for bawip-tahag: Raleth Quenok

For the weekly sync: the Fernwick CDN incident traced to unsigned cache entries surviving a purge. Old artifacts served for six hours post-release. Fix: all cache objects now carry a signature checked at edge; mismatches trigger immediate eviction. Purge tooling updated; dashboards track verification failures. Action items: rotate the edge verification key quarterly, add canary checks pre-release, document eviction SLAs. Owners assigned in the tracker. Edge nodes must be provisioned with the current key, shown below.

release key, fahaf-bajof: bky3_Xam